I joined the RAAF in 1973 and was trained in the use of gas masks and actions to take if a nuclear war came about.

I've mixed with Vietnam Veterans and had family members in WW2.

I've kept watch as a keen observer of the "recent" wars- Serbia, Iraq and Afghanistan. However, all the yelling and threats from some countries has always fizzled out at a certain point. My point is that Russia's mention of using whatever force is necessary does not means it will result in a nuclear exchange. If it did then imo Russia would lose as USA, UK, Germany and France is too powerful as a united force. The real worry is the devastation and human survival. Yes, these are issues to worry about but are highly unlikely. We must embrace the concept of "highly unlikely" not fall into the trap of catastrophising.

That's my take on this war or any other.
